1956 Ferrari 500 Testarossa vs. 2000 SsangYong Korando

To start off, 2000 SsangYong Korando is newer by 44 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1956 Ferrari 500 Testarossa.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1956 Ferrari 500 Testarossa would be higher. At 2,295 cc (4 cylinders), 2000 SsangYong Korando is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1956 Ferrari 500 Testarossa (187 HP @ 7000 RPM) has 45 more horse power than 2000 SsangYong Korando. (142 HP @ 5600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1956 Ferrari 500 Testarossa should accelerate faster than 2000 SsangYong Korando.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2000 SsangYong Korando weights approximately 1185 kg more than 1956 Ferrari 500 Testarossa.

Because 2000 SsangYong Korando is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1956 Ferrari 500 Testarossa.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2000 SsangYong Korando will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2000 SsangYong Korando (210 Nm @ 2860 RPM) has 5 more torque (in Nm) than 1956 Ferrari 500 Testarossa. (205 Nm @ 5500 RPM). This means 2000 SsangYong Korando will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1956 Ferrari 500 Testarossa.

Compare all specifications:

1956 Ferrari 500 Testarossa 2000 SsangYong Korando
Make Ferrari SsangYong
Model 500 Testarossa Korando
Year Released 1956 2000
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1985 cc 2295 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 187 HP 142 HP
Engine RPM 7000 RPM 5600 RPM
Torque 205 Nm 210 Nm
Torque RPM 5500 RPM 2860 RPM
Engine Bore Size 90 mm 90.9 mm
Engine Stroke Size 78 mm 88.4 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 8.8:1 10.4:1
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line - Premium
Top Speed 257 km/hour 165 km/hour
Drive Type Rear 4WD
Number of Seats 2 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Weight 680 kg 1865 kg
Vehicle Length 4320 mm 4340 mm
Vehicle Height 1310 mm 1850 mm
Wheelbase Size 2260 mm 2490 mm
